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
027991575 312357 035 0793
784 138376806
784 138376806
89751790 595018254 1001791
All about undefined
Interested in learning more?
784 138376806
89751790 595018254 1001791
See more
9259 032211861 84480
0796 3266527654 921927
See more
5499424740 705886717
49 65816162386 595207
See more